Proton Power Installs Manufacturing Robot To Ramp Up Production

Tue, 28th May 2019 11:34

LONDON (Alliance News) - Proton Power Systems PLC on Tuesday said it is installing a stack manufacturing robot to increase production capacity to 5,000 fuel cell units per year.

Proton Power Systems shares were trading 28% higher at 37.88 pence.

The company, which designs, develops and produces fuel cells, said it decided to install the robot after it saw "clear signs" that demand for hydrogen fuel cells is "rapidly increasing".

Furthermore, in order to meet future increasing demand, the company has put in place plans to modify the machine layout to be able to produce up to 30,000 stack units per year.

"We are delighted with this important development in the company's progress as it contributes greatly to manufacturing ability and puts Proton in a commanding position to receive larger quantity orders before the end of 2020," Chair Helmut Gierse said.
